Public Diplomacy in a Global Context

MPP 676

(3 units)

In contrast with diplomacy—which usually takes place behind closed doors—public diplomacy is foreign policy through engagement with foreign publics. How do governments cultivate public opinion in other countries? How do diplomats communicate in order to advance their country's foreign policy? This course will examine the history, issues, and practices of public diplomacy. Students will help break new ground by researching the role, structure, and integration of public diplomacy within the policy realm in other countries.
